在名额有限的情况下如何组织线上活动报名?

某个活动名额固定。该活动有很多人都想参加,且这个活动会不定期开展多次,每次一发布活动就有很多人同时报名,该怎么区分谁先谁后呢?

活动限制人数、通过群聊进入活动报名页面(除此之外还有手机扫码、朋友圈、链接等方式)并且可以自定义活动时间。这些需求表预约就可以实现,并且可以实现报名后,生成核销码,只有活动当天出场人员才能现场扫码签到,防止人员占用名额却不到场,并且可以一键导出人员名单,签到情况可以一目了然。

表预约可以实现活动在线报名登记信息收集活动现场签到等,请跟随小编一起了解相关功能。

表预约功能介绍

1、限时限额报名、现场扫码核销

用户通过手机即可查看活动说明,选择合适的时间,填写报名信息,生成现场签到二维码(一人一码)。

活动现场,用户出示报名时生成的核销码,工作人员扫码确认信息,即可完成现场签到。

2、导出Excel数据、多人授权管理

如果需要统计每场活动的报名人员信息,可以将数据一键导出生成Excel文件,方便后续的统计分析

支持设置多名管理员,并授予他们进行不同的权限。工作人员协同核销,提高用户进场速度。

3、自定义报名信息,不能重复报名

为了满足不同活动的需求,自定义预约填写信息,包括单选、多选、单行文本、多行文本、下拉框、图片、地址等多种形式。

同时,您还可以设置不能重复报名,确保活动名额不会被额外占用。

4、其他功能

如预约成功实时通知、自定义预约时间范围、临时关闭某个预约内容、随时修改预约设置以及确保预约数据互不可见等。

表预约创建步骤(仅需三步)

1、进入表预约主页后选择上方“新建预约”

2、选择模板(多种场景模板自由选择)或空白预约,填写预约名称、预约须知和预约设置(根据需求选择预约设置),点击创建表单

3、设置循环规则、添加预约组(可自定义预约内容和限制人数),设置预约时需填写的信息,点击保存即可完成创建。

### 批量抢报名名额的技术实现方法与工具 批量抢报名名额通常涉及自动化脚本开发以及网络请求的快速响应能力。以下是几种可能的技术实现方式及其相关工具: #### 1. **基于编程语言的自动化脚本** 可以使用 Python 或其他支持 HTTP 请求的语言来编写自动化脚本来完成批量抢报名的任务。Python 的 `requests` 库用于发送 HTTP 请求,而 `selenium` 则可用于模拟浏览器行为。 ```python import requests def batch_register(url, data_list): headers = { "User-Agent": "Mozilla/5.0 (Windows NT 10.0; Win64; x64)" } results = [] for data in data_list: response = requests.post(url, json=data, headers=headers) results.append(response.json()) return results ``` 上述代码展示了如何通过 POST 请求向服务器提交数据以尝试抢占名额[^1]。 #### 2. **Selenium 自动化工具** 如果目标网站有复杂的验证码或者动态加载内容,则需要借助 Selenium 来模拟真实用户的操作过程。Selenium 支持多种浏览器驱动程序(如 ChromeDriver 和 GeckoDriver),能够更灵活地应对复杂场景。 ```python from selenium import webdriver driver = webdriver.Chrome() driver.get("https://example.com/register") # 填充表单并提交 form_fields = driver.find_elements_by_tag_name('input') for field, value in zip(form_fields[:len(data)], data.values()): field.send_keys(value) submit_button = driver.find_element_by_id('submit-button') submit_button.click() driver.quit() ``` 此部分代码说明了如何利用 Selenium 实现网页交互功能[^2]。 #### 3. **多线程或多进程加速** 为了提高效率,在实际应用中还可以引入多线程或多进程技术来并发执行多个请求任务。这样不仅可以加快速度还能增加成功概率。 ```python from concurrent.futures import ThreadPoolExecutor with ThreadPoolExecutor(max_workers=10) as executor: futures = [executor.submit(batch_register, url, single_data) for single_data in data_list] responses = [future.result() for future in futures] ``` 这里介绍了通过创建线程池来进行并发处理的方式[^3]。 #### 注意事项 尽管存在这些技术和手段可以帮助实现批量抢报名的功能,但在具体实施过程中需要注意遵守法律法规和服务条款,避免因不当使用而导致法律风险或其他后果。 --- ###
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值